The Joyce Group Agency logo

The Joyce Group

Business, Financial & Professional Services Website

The Joyce Group is a Calgary-based strategic consulting firm founded in 1992 with over 25 years of experience in strategy planning, finance, and international expansion. It helps businesses navigate complex transitions such as global growth, operational efficiency improvements, and financial challenges. The firm also serves government bodies and non-governmental organizations.
